Earth Under Siege in "Sphere Defense"

Author : Zachary Jan 10,2025

Outsmart relentless enemy waves and defend the sphere in Sphere Defense, the captivating new tower defense game from developer Tomoki Fukushima! The core gameplay revolves around strategic unit placement and resource management to upgrade your defenses against increasingly challenging levels.

What sets Sphere Defense apart is its minimalist aesthetic, featuring sleek neon visuals that add a unique flair to the classic tower defense formula. Successfully repelling attacks earns you resources to enhance your units and secure victory. Master the art of defense, survive waves unscathed for high scores, and conquer the ultimate bragging rights!

yt

Inspired by the iconic "geoDefense" by David Whatley, Fukushima aims to capture the charm and beauty of that classic title in a modern package. He states, "This game was developed as a homage to 'geoDefense', a tower defence game created over 10 years ago by David Whatley. When I played 'geoDefense', I was deeply impressed by how such a simple game could be so fun and beautiful."
